4. Interesting. The bottom four are best, you say.
Do you think it's possible (I've wondered this about myself as well) that the also-rans somehow seem more appealing because they're on the bottom--so that all you hear about them is their substantive takes on the issues?

I share your bias. But I wonder if, say, Dodd broke thru we'd all be saying he's an out-of-touch old school deal brokering eastern elitist with a suspiciously youthful trophy wife.

Certainly if Biden broke out of the pack, he'd start getting a lot of bundled corporate donations and we'd start dismissing him as a show-horse and a prima dona and a tool of the corporations that own Delaware.

I sometimes wonder if I don't just have a soft spot for the underdog too much.
